Is it safe to keep fully charged hearing aids in charger when not using

1 comments:
Mr. Anderson
May 18, 2025

Yes, it is safe to keep Rexton C R-Li hearing aids fully charged in the charger when not in use for a short period (several days or weeks), as long as the charger is plugged into a power outlet. For long-term storage (many weeks or months), fully charge the hearing aids, turn them off via the rocker switch, and store them in an unplugged standard charger or a powered-off travel charger.
